After the scenes, limbs and euphoria of a McTominay overhead bicycle stunner, a Tierney peach and a Kenny Fekkin MacLean whopper, there's a more mundane task ahead as Queen of the South are our visitors on Saturday. It's scheduled for a 17:30pm kick-off in League1 as we endeavour to consolidate our position at the top of the table. We managed that without playing last weekend but Queens can be a difficult proposition at times and are not to be underestimated. Queens will be looking to get involved in the race for a place, currently only five points behind the Caley Jags. Weather wise it's been a pretty chilly week with snow showers leaving a fine blanket on the surface and we are taking nothing for granted by getting the covers down early before the frost gets any worse.

That KDM fixture resulted in an emphatic rain soaked 6-0 win with Chanka Zimba notching a hat-trick, a brace for Alfie Bavidge and one for Jordan Alonge.

Billy Mckay and Ross Millen are still recovering with Jake Davidson out long term although Millen could return to the squad and Billy is making good progress and is ahead of schedule.

Queens at Kelty last Saturday which ended 1-1 with Kai Kennedy scoring a penalty to open the scoring just after the break with Diack levelling five minutes later.

Some great results in there beating Accies (1-2) and East Fife (3-0) but countered by a couple of disappointing ones at Montrose and Peterhead.
Top scorer is Kurtis Guthrie with 4, Kennedy and Jack Stott with 3 apiece.
